Hello everyone.


My name is ‘Kaito,’ and I’m a 17-year-old junior in high school.

I like working out, video games, and wasting time. I hate responsibilities and public speaking.

And right now, I’m sitting in a shaky wooden wagon being dragged through the dark wilderness by some kind of lizard-horse hybrid.

Why?

“Ah, that’s because I’m a slave.”

“Who are you talking to?”

The cart sways gently as it travels, but I remain still. Well, mostly because I can’t move. Two armed people flank me on either side, their weapons resting lazily across their laps. The interior of the wagon is surprisingly decent, furnished with a bench and a thin carpet stretched across the wooden floor.

There are rectangular openings on each wall, likely meant as makeshift windows, though they're just wide enough to throw someone out of. If I weren’t so close to one of those windows, I would have leaped out myself a long time ago.

A collar rests tight around my neck. It's a black metal device, cold against my skin.

 

Shortly after the woman known as Navi-I-forgot-her-last-name declared me as her slave, she quickly outfitted me with the collar around my neck, the thing closing quite quickly.

 

Judging by the sick smile on her face, I can come to the conclusion that she enjoyed every second, something that scares me.

I’m still processing the fact that I’m a slave.

Couldn’t I at least be a servant?

Don’t slaves do more laborious work, while servants get to do more household work?

I always figured if I got isekai’d, I’d at least get magic powers or a sword. Instead, I got a legally binding iron choker.

Dammit.

I guess I’ve come to accept my circumstances. It’s much better than being ripped to shreds by god-knows-what in that forest.
I sigh and glance to my left.

I turn to my left, where a young woman, who seems to be around my age, sits, writing down on what I assume to be a scroll. She’s wearing white fitted armor, with a navy black coat draped over her shoulders. She has long, flowing, black hair complemented by purple eyes, something that sends a warning signal up my brain.

Is that natural?

She has a calm, dignified air to her, like someone you’d see in a library.

Maybe she’s nice?

“You a slave too?” I say, attempting to start some kind of conversation.

She remains fixed on the scroll. “No. I am a member of this party.”

What a concise answer. Too concise.

“I see, I see,” I say, nodding my head. “Uh, do you think you can do me a favor and try to convince Snowball over there to let me go? You seem rational. Also morally grounded.. probably.”

Maybe she can do something about my impending doom. Please, do something.

 

Use the goodness in your pure heart.

The woman stops writing, then looks at me, her eyes full of what I hope to be confusion. Her head doesn’t shift with the wagon’s sway, and for a brief second, I swear she’s a mannequin with skin.

“You have not even introduced yourself, yet you ask a favor from me? Do you lack basic manners? I see now why Lieutenant Highergald has brought you in as a slave.”

 

I agree with the first part of what she said, yet the second part feels like a stab in the gut. The tone of her voice cuts through my gut as well, adding insult to injury.

I’m about to utter something that’d be better off not said when a pair of arms wrap themselves around my neck, choking me.

“Hmph—Ghh?!”

I get pulled back.

“Aw! Is he already trying to escape? That’s not fair, Mr. Slave, you haven’t even been with us for long!”

The voice is high-pitched and cheerful, belonging to a ponytailed girl, her eyes large and wide. She’s wearing a closed jacket, but I can still see the armor underneath. She’s clearly smaller than me, with a face most guys would label as a ‘knockout’.

Yeah, more like I’m going to knock her out as soon as I get out.

 

Perhaps the most unique thing about her is the strange insignia under her left eye.

By the way, is this jacket over armor some kind of fashion?

Never mind that, this crazy bitch is gonna choke me out!!

“Khkhh!”

“Arivia, you’re strangling him.”

“Huh? How can you tell?”

Maybe my flailing hands and my purple face, idiot!

Said ‘Arivia’ releases my head from her clutches, leaving me a choking and coughing mess. I’ve come too close to death too many times for comfort, seriously.

She seems quite unbothered, her face looking as if she just finished playing with her favorite toy.

I grab at my neck, hoping I can at least feel the skin, but alas, I’m met with cold, hard metal.

She turns her head to the person leading the weird horse lizard things. Navi.

“Say, Navi, how’d you come across this guy anyway?” Arivia calls out, looking toward the front of the wagon.

The voice calls back.

“First off, it’s Lieutenant Navi. Second, I found him with a mimic, the guy was about to be fed to a whole nest of them. I guess you could say I saved him, but I really was just there to take it out.”

“What even is a mimi-”

“A mimic, more commonly known as a Mimos, a creature that often takes the form of others, luring victims into a nest, then consuming them. Mimic populations often are located in the province of Nyassarenth, specifically within west and east Norovia.”


I turn to the long-haired woman.

Her eyes are closed as if she’s memorized the words by heart.

“Man, Asakawa’s so cool!” Arivia exclaims, her hands clasped together. “Memorizing passages like that... it’s amazing!”

How can someone be so optimistic when someone in front of them is getting sent off to slavery? No, seriously, it’s quite concerning. She’s talking like an excited schoolgirl despite the grim occurrence in front of her.

I get being optimistic, but it’s quite scary at this point.

The night wind whistles softly through the wagon, the clatter of wheels a constant drumbeat beneath us. Every now and then, I hear a distant animal cry or something rustle in the trees

“Speaking of, Arivia, do we have a place for the slave to stay?” The girl, Navi asks from the front.

“Didn't I tell you my name earlier for a reason…”

“Huh, what was that, Kaito the Slave?”

Arivia snickers.

Even Asakawa covers her mouth, her shoulders lightly trembling.

Aren’t you the cold, composed type!? You’re breaking character!!

I groan, leaning back.

I feel the floorboards creak in front of me, presumably someone approaching me.

“Don’t worry, Mr slave, you’ll be living nice and cozy!”

I perk my head up.

“Yup! You get your very own barn! Fresh hay! And you don’t even need a toilet!”

“...You mean there isn’t one, don’t you.”

“Same thing, right?”

I bury my face in my hands.

“…Do you enjoy mocking me?”

She's not nodding, but judging by the look on her face, she's enjoying every second of it.

 

In a final plea, I turn to her with tired eyes.

 

“Please… just let me go.”

Hopefully, she gets my predicament and will understand and empathize with the poor boy in front of her. After all, there has to be someone here with a good heart! There’s absolutely no way somebody would be alright with accepting a slave, right? Basic empathy articulates so.

There must be some good inside these people!

Arivia raises a lantern to my face. I wince a little at the sudden brightness.


“Hey, Asa…”

Yes, say something like: ‘I don’t know, I feel kinda bad…’!




“He looks like a cat, right?”




“Nope, you’re all heartless monsters!!”

“Yes, I can see it. His pupils are quite small, like a cat’s.”

Is this the rest of my life? Working for a bunch of girls who should be in school, enduring countless insults, and being forced to work like a bull?

Is this where my life is headed?

Ever since I’ve been sent to this world, everything has gone wrong. I have no responsibilities, yet I'm tortured with other methods. Is this a cruel joke?

My shoulders shake like I’m going to start laughing or crying. Or both.

And that causes something I was hoping to avoid. Something I feared from the very bottom of my heart.

“Hey, Asa, there's something in his pocket!”

No, not my smartphone. Please.

Arivia crawls over to me, grabbing my poor phone. If I attempt to even take it away from her, I’m sure she wouldn’t even hesitate to lop my hand off, so that's not an option.

She holds it up to her face, confused by it.

If I recall, it’s on about 70% with the camera shattered. Most probably due to the various things that happened earlier.

To these people, who look like they walked straight out of a medieval-themed gacha game, it might as well be alien tech.

If I rate them by stars, it’ll be something akin to, Asakawa a 4 star, Navi a 5, Arivia a…

Wait, focus.

Arivia dangles it as Asakawa inches closer, observing the phone. By the way, the two of them ignore my presence and are practically leaning on my poor head. I’d be excited if it weren't for these two being utter monsters.

“It seems to be a device of some kind.”

Arivia glances at me, an excited look on her face.

“What is this, do ya know?”

I sigh.

“It’s a smartphone.”

“Smart.. Phone?”

“Yeah, it’s basically a..”

Wait, I can take advantage of this situation. They're painfully unaware of this 21st-century masterpiece.

“A bomb. It’s a bomb that activates whenever I want. Yes, the blast radius is enormous, and it’ll take out everything near us. So if you don’t release me-”

“Mr. Slave, do you think we’re stupid?”

“Eh?”

“If this were any kind of weapon, you would’ve used it hours ago. Now I want you to really think about that.”

“..I uh, I was saving it for when I get to your base! So I can blow it all to hell!”

I know it’s a failed convincing attempt, but it’ll work if I believe.

Arivia ignores me completely and turns to Asakawa, pointing something out on the phone. A few seconds later, they’re both giggling. Giggling.

They’re ignoring me!

Their faces glow under the soft blue light of the screen, eyes locked on whatever they’ve uncovered. Meanwhile, I’m just… here. The human furniture they’re leaning on.

A smile across Asakawa’s face makes me uneasy.

Wait, how did they even unlock it? Wait, no, I think the face recognition software opened it for them, since they did point it at me earlier.

Dammit, figure out what they’re seeing that’s making them laugh! I try to angle my head to view what exactly they’re laughing at.

Arivia quickly turns the phone around, pushing it in my face.

“Mr slave, is this you?” She says through laughter.

It’s a picture of me, flexing in a mirror, sticking my lips out.

My face turns a bright red.

I often used to take pictures of myself after every day working out, to get the dopamine release that my efforts were actually going somewhere. But if someone ever found out, I’d die of embarrassment, mainly because of the faces I make.

And that’s what’s going on.

“Well? Anything to say?” she teases, swiping gleefully through my photo gallery.

Wait, how did she figure that already? How is she already that comfortable with the interface?

Are people really into this kind of thing? Being labeled a slave and getting insulted? Well, I’m not that kind of person, so please, god, get me out!

Still giggling, she crawls to the front of the cart to show the phone to my final enemy.

I hear it. The snicker.

“Kill me now…”
